DISCLAIMER: LONG READ
I've been wanting to comment in this thread for awhile. My process in becoming a SWV listener and Coko stan has been weird LOL. I've always known SWV but I'm into groups who heavily use harmony and have multiple leads (EV, DC, Brownstone) so SWV didn't appeal to me. I remember I'm So Into You was cute and that I loved the hell outta Anything with that fantastic bridge where Coko let go and let have. The girls at the talent shows would sing Weak but the recorded version never did much for me. And who could forget those damn footlong nails? Women are still rocking that style LOL. I never realized Rain was sung by a group until I bought SWV's greatest hits when they came back with I Missed Us. Before I go any further, I have to say that Rain personifies quiet storm radio to me. I used to stay listening to the radio during my teenage years and Power 98 would always start their quiet storm hour with this song and it would instantly relax and move me. One of the greatest songs EVER made. Fast forward to 2006, when I joined MCP's forum and there was this kid named Terrell that used to go UP for Coko's first gospel album. He tried to tell me how good it was but I wasn't sold on whatever song he told me to listen to mostly because of a lack of annointing. I remember people trying to tell me how great a singer Coko was but nothing I had heard from her electrified me. I took it as overblown fluff. I laughed so hard when SWV popped up during Alicia Keys' performance and not only looked a mess but sounded a mess too (Sorry Coko). The blogs had a field day with it and it just made me love my funky divas more.
I never thought anymore of them until the She Ain't You remix dropped and I'm like "who is killing these wails like that and damn these vocals have the same pizzazz that made me love Anything." Co-Sign comes out and I'm like "wait a minute, I didn't know Coko could blow like that" so now I'm interested in hearing this new album. I Missed Us made me love Coko's talent as one of the best lead singers of all time. I don't like Taj or LeLee's voices, they both sound like somebody's drunk aunt at the family cookout. When the producer autotune their voices correctly and place them in the right part of the song then they aren't as noticeable which makes for easier listening (Love Unconditionally, All About You, There'll Never Be) otherwise when they take lead I have to skip because I CAN'T DEAL (Best Years, Better Than I, I Missed Us). Their harmony is pretty much nonexistent as well which shows the greatness of Coko since she's the star attraction here. Do Ya, Keep Ya Home and Everything i Love are just perfection with how her voice glides up and down, bends here and swoop there like a master skier. I was told to go buy their greatest hits to really get a better sense of them as a group. So I did and I discovered the forgotten jazzy slow jam that is Use Your Heart. I couldn't believe that Taj could actually sound decent and add contrast to Coko. I didn't know LeLee sung on Can We, her part is real cute and leads to my second favorite BELT by Coko. I didn't realize they had so many hits but nothing really made me want to go further into their respective discography...
...well that was until this year's unveiling of SWV Reunited. This show has made me an actual fan of this iconic group (and a stan for Mrs. Clemons who serves up entitled only child brattiness with ghetto fabulous sassiness). I love how much personality they possess that doesn't come across in their music except on a few selected songs. I believe them as around the way broads being in touch with their freaky side, hoeing around with another woman's guy that made their biggest hits so memorable. They have so much material just based on LeLee's life experiences and Taj's home life for a classic album. I've hunted down all of their secular work and I understand why Coko couldn't make it solo. Besides the wrong singles, SWV gave her an identity that she didn't have on her solo recording. SWV never made a great album or had the best blend but they defined their era and have the rare ability to adept to a new generation without blinking an eye. Songs which showcase the best of SWV's interplay are buried on compilations dying to be heard and appreciated (Mystery, Surprise Me) while outside guests steal the scene and render them useless (Release Some Tension album). A mess. A lot of the songs just need a better arrangement and structure for not only the other girls to shine on but to support Coko's voice. I recently just streamed both of Coko's gospel albums and they are both such clear stellar statements of who Coko is as a vocalist and as an artist. She comes alive in ways that I didn't know she could. Her voice is truly a work of art and her command over it is awesome. I was sleeping hard on her skills because I now understand that Coko inspired alot of female singers from Ashanti to Beyonce (Destiny's Child first album) to Mariah (Fantasy remix). She's unsung and its a shame her gospel efforts went unawarded.
I'm excited for the next season of this show. While other reality shows made me dislike an artist I once loved, this show has made me appreciate an artist who I had ignored/dismissed long ago. Thanks Terrell, you were right.
